Senior Manager of Finance
Description
The Finance Manager is a critical leadership role responsible for overseeing financial accounting operations, internal and external reporting, and financial forecast and analysis functions. This role will lead a team to ensure accurate financial records, timely reporting, robust forecasting, and insightful analysis to support strategic decision-making and drive operational efficiency across the organization.
Essential Functions:
- Lead, mentor, and develop a team of finance professionals, fostering a collaborative and high-performance work environment.
- Oversee and ensure the accurate and timely completion of all month-end, quarter-end, and year-end closing activities.
- Oversee all aspects of cost accounting, including standard costing, activity-based costing, and variance analysis.
- Identify key trends, risks, and opportunities, providing actionable insights and recommendations to support business strategies and operational improvements.
- Work closely with cross-functional teams to gather inputs, build financial models, and analyze assumptions.
- Provide clear and concise commentary on financial performance, variances, and trends.
- Identify opportunities to streamline and improve financial processes, systems, and controls to enhance efficiency, accuracy, and compliance.
- Proactively identify and evaluate opportunities to apply AI and automation technologies to streamline financial processes, reduce manual effort, and improve operational efficiency within the finance department.
- Assist in the preparation and review of corporate accounting policies and procedures.
- Fulfill request of external quarterly review and annual audit.
- Assist with special projects as required.

Qualifications/Experience:
- Bachelor’s degree in accounting or related field.
- At least 8 years of experience in accounting or finance.
- Computer industry work experience is preferred.
- Strong knowledge of GAAP/IFRS and financial reporting requirements.
- Proven expertise in month-end closing, cost accounting, inventory management, budgeting, forecasting, and financial analysis.
- Effective written and verbal communication skill of Chinese/ Mandarin is a plus.
$150,000 - $170,000 annually is the estimated pay range for this role working in Fremont, California office. It does not include bonuses, medical, dental, vision, life insurance, AD&D insurance, Paid Time Off, EAP, & 401(k). The final amount will be determined based on the qualifications & experience of the candidate relative to the role.
